The regular ones have a larger page size, similar to the hardcover versions. The mass market are the typical small 4"x7" pages, the regular are like 6"x9". The mass market have more pages since the pages are smaller. For example, A Game of Thrones - mass market paperback 831 pages, regular paperback 704 pages.

Paperback VS Mass Market Paperback: A Comprehensive Comparison Table. Trade Paperbacks are usually taller and wider. Mass market are usually shorter and thicker. Print is usually easier to read on paperback. Paper quality usually better. Massmarket has rougher paper and smaller print. Trade paperbacks are usually more expensive. Mass Market are volume prints for cheaper cost. Elsecaller_17-5.

When we talk about paperback book printing, we typically mean trade paperbacks, which are the 6x9 or 5.5x8.5–inch books you see most often in bookstores. Mass-market is a type of paperback you often see used for romance novels or thrillers. Mass-market books are usually smaller in trim size and fatter with a thinner, …Beginning with titles going on sale on September 29, 2020, Kensington said it will replace the standard 4.125 by 6.75-inch mass market paperback with a larger 4.75 by 7-inch format called “Mass ...

But the volume of sales can compensate. According to Scribe Media, on average, traditional publishers pay the following rates: Hardcover sales: 15%; Trade paperback sales: 7.5%; Mass-market paperback sales: 5%; The Publisher’s Perspective.
